Output 17c7c823768f02fed2851daed4609bf86ceae109e9cbbaba7e4eaed366626208:0

value
20870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8771118fb44ea8e2309b65e6b4a1cc314a9895 OP_EQUAL
address
35fBESm7tSgX1j5g4WmwFULidWpW8Tq5af
transaction
17c7c823768f02fed2851daed4609bf86ceae109e9cbbaba7e4eaed366626208
spent
true